Memorable Moments and Quotes
Some of Georgina’s best lines remain etched in fans’ memories. Lines like, “I haven’t been this bored since I believed in Jesus,” showcase her sharp wit and irreverent humor. Another classic: “It’s not what I’m gonna do, sweetie… It’s who I’m gonna do it with.” These quotes encapsulate her larger-than-life personality and cement her status as a fan favorite.
In the finale, titled The Wrong Goodbye, Georgina appears married to Philip Becker and living in Brooklyn. Attending the Constance/St. Jude’s alumni gala, she reconnects with old acquaintances, bringing closure to her storyline. Though brief, her appearance highlights the cyclical nature of relationships within the show.

Fan Reactions and Speculation
Fans frequently debated whether Georgina could have been the original Gossip Girl before acquiring the blog. Given her familiarity with key players and penchant for gossip, it seemed plausible. However, inconsistencies arose regarding her relationship with Dan Humphrey, suggesting otherwise.
Others questioned plot holes surrounding her disappearance and reappearance throughout the series. For instance, when Georgina lied about her identity during Season 1, how did Dan fail to recognize her despite being privy to insider information? Such mysteries fueled discussions and kept fans engaged long after episodes aired.
